Date: Sat Aug 24 16:36:00 2019 +0800 发布dimmer-V1.0.31 1、修改固件版本1.0.31; 2、频率检测和调光优化; Date: Sat Aug 24 11:42:50 2019 +0800 发布dimmer-V1.0.30 1、修改固件版本1.0.30; 2、设置最小亮度模式下的亮度也保存到flash; 3、修复schedule执行结果上报错误; Date: Fri Aug 23 11:29:29 2019 +0800 发布dimmer-V1.0.29 1、固件版本修改为1.0.29; 2、修复禅道的bug; 3、schedule查询代码重构; 4、修复schedule的bug; Date: Mon Aug 12 12:16:26 2019 +0800 发布dimmer-V1.0.28 1、增加了bypassV2接口,用调最低亮度匹配功能。 2、增加schedule重构。 3、增加了schedule查询。 Date: Thu Jun 20 14:58:18 2019 +0800 发布dimmer-V1.0.27 1、修改按键进入产测, wifi指示灯闪10次. 2、产测连接成功,wifi指示灯保持亮。 Date: Wed Jun 19 19:05:04 2019 +0800 发布dimmer-V1.0.26 1、照明灯开启,power指示灯灭。 照明灯关闭,power指示灯亮。亮度指示灯状态同照明灯。 2、照明灯关闭,按键UP/DOWN按键可以开启照明灯。 3、RGB氛围灯不受照明灯开关影响,只通过app控制。 4、schedule 的start不执行,关闭执行时, 不点亮灯后关闭。 5、调光结束后,1秒钟内保存数据。 6、默认RGB出厂颜色:浅蓝色。 7、连接网络成功后,wifi指示灯灭。 8、灯光软启时间调整为最长1s左右,亮度越低,时间越短。 9、release版本需要打印级别默认设置WARN。 10、修复schedule跨天问题。 11、注册包取消otp字段上报。 Date: Tue Jun 18 17:48:36 2019 +0800 发布dimmer-V1.0.25 1、修改固件版本1.0.25; 2、增加调试手段设置时间戳,用于测试schedule; 3、修复dimmer schedule不执行的bug; #7426; 4、修改基线代码版本2.4.5; 4.1、修复测试命令设置时间戳接口bug导致时间无法同步问题; 4.2、设置WiFi为省电模式(默认是modem-sleep模式); 4.3、MQTT的keepalive间隔虽设置为30sec,但实际心跳发送间隔是15sec; 4.4、修复MQTT队列异常时,出现死锁的问题,导致设备一直离线(实际是在线); 4.5、修复配网过程中重新触发配网,会因为ERR65错误打断配网; 4.6、开发者模式支持产测试命令; 4.7、公共代码增加schedule cycle模块; 4.8、配置WiFi参数借口改为不保存flash接口; 4.9、修复升级失败后不能重复升级的问题; 4.10、升级乐鑫sdk到v2.2.x(6a174c526d4f8cba2c7aff51469540d8a5dd7259); 4.11、修复加载字符串函数string_load_from_flash因为变量地址没有4字节对齐导致重启的问题; Date: Mon May 27 17:23:58 2019 +0800 发布dimmer-V1.0.24 1、修改产测温度上报值,温度大于60度,上报60度,小于60度上报25; 2、产测完成恢复到出厂设置状态; 3、按键调亮度改为:20,30,50.70,100; 4、RGB灯默认出厂亮度(255/10); Date: Mon May 20 14:26:57 2019 +0800 发布dimmer-V1.0.23 1、修改RGB亮度过亮问题; 2、长按开关键15秒,恢复出厂设置,RGB氛围灯蓝色打开,灯泡亮度100%; 3、版本迭代为1.0.23; Date: Sun Apr 28 14:32:24 2019 +0800 发布dimmer-V1.0.22 1、修复了在app上设置rgb开关,无法正常控制问题; 2、更新基线版本2.4.3; 2.1)、配网优先使用域名连接服务器; 2.2)、配网信息中增加剩余内存返回,用于定位62错误; 2.3)、配网connect info信息增加定时上报,时间间隔5秒; 2.4)、基线使用的字符串存flash优化内存空间; 2.5)、配网时增加连接路由器超时错误码,超时时间为30秒; Date: Fri Apr 19 18:13:02 2019 +0800 发布dimmer-V1.0.20 1、优化了,只有在打开灯开关才会上报code字段 Date: Fri Apr 19 10:48:45 2019 +0800 发布dimmer-V1.0.19 1、修复了1.0.18版本升级后,导致工作异常问题; 2、修改了code字段返回位置,code字段跟state字段平级; 3、增加了app测试NTC专用代码; Date: Mon Apr 15 11:17:37 2019 +0800 发布dimmer-V1.0.18 Date: Thu Apr 4 09:44:50 2019 +0800 发布dimmer-V1.0.17 1、优化NTC算法,过温触发方法; Date: Tue Apr 2 11:02:10 2019 +0800 发布dimmer-V1.0.16 1、增加ntc溫度採集,过温保护功能; 2、增加产测,检测硬件良好性; 3、增加过温后,触发通知服务器 "otp" :"on"; 4、合并基线代码2.3.5; 4.1) APN配网模式过程中,关闭热点后WiFi指示灯熄灭; 4.2) 解决编译user_main.c时找不到build_cfg.h的问题; 4.3) 固件升级时不进行mqtt重连,防止内存不足到重启; 4.4) 固件升级时增加版本号为空的异常处理; 4.5) 将扫描到的WiFi列表分多帧发送,每一帧独立加密,增加字段对帧进行描述; 4.6) 配网时调用WIFI_Connect,增加5次清零路由器操作; 4.7) 当RSSI等于31时,累加两次才上报log; 4.8) 增加配网获取设备日志功能; 4.9) 增加设备配网连接信息日志,以及连接路由错误码; 4.10) 增加配网不支持的命令返回; 4.11) WiFi列表过滤掉重复的ssid; 4.12) 配网时app tcp连入后重新计算配网超时时间; 4.13) 配网取消历史记录和固件版本主动上报,改为app查询方式; 4.14) 配网失败如果未跟app保持连接,自动取消配网; 4.15) 修复APP发送完配网信息后强制关闭,设备连接服务器成功后不会取消配网关闭热点的问题; 5、合并基线2.3.7 5.1、配网tcp发送超时改用espconn_disconnect释放tcp; 5.2、配网时增加连接路由器超时错误码,超时时间为30秒; Date: Fri Jan 25 14:09:39 2019 +0800 发布dimmer-V1.0.15 1、取消smart配网模式; 2、合并基线版本v2.3.3; 2.1、修复已连接wifi的情况下,进入产测模式复位的问题; 2.2、增加断网2分钟超时重连wifi; 2.3、针对路由器出现的域名解析返回局域ip导致的重连失败,轮流使用域名和ip去重连服务器,解决sdk域名解析错误导致重连失败的问题; 2.4、esp8266乐鑫sdk回退到v2.2.0; 2.5、增加连接服务器上报重连原因字段; Date: Tue Jan 15 11:10:34 2019 +0800 发布dimmer-V1.0.14 1、更新固件版本号到v1.0.14; Date: Mon Jan 14 18:17:29 2019 +0800 发布dimmer-V1.0.13 1、增加宏UNIFIED_PRODUCTION_WIFI,实现进入产测时采用统一的SSID、PASSWORD; Date: Fri Jan 11 15:37:12 2019 +0800 发布dimmer-V1.0.12 1、解决了亮度为51%时,档位指示灯不显示在第四档的问题;bug编号#4307 Date: Wed Jan 9 17:19:29 2019 +0800 发布dimmer-V1.0.11 1、灯光6档位调光,改成5档位调光; 2、APN热点配网名称改成 Etekcity_Dimmer; 3、合并基线版本2.3.2; 3.1、build_cfg.h增加统一产测WiFi宏定义UNIFIED_PRODUCTION_WIFI; 3.2、通过mqtt数据包发送返回值判断tcp断开,紧急修复无法检测离线的问题; 3.3、配网过程中固件版本和cid剥离出来单独发送给app; 3.4、修复非配网状态下记录wifi断开日志的bug; 3.5、修改mqtt发送数据包超时时间8秒; 3.6、mqtt心跳包通过队列发送,防止心跳包和数据包发送冲突导致掉线的问题; 3.7、增加重启原因异常的信息上报服务器; 3.8、build_cfg.h增加热点名称宏定义DEVICE_AP_NAME,可通过该宏定义热点名称; 3.9、配网日志中增加cid; 3.10、增加路由器连接错误码在配网日志中的传输; 3.11、修复55555端口打印日志有时会有遗漏的问题; Date: Sat Dec 29 17:49:24 2018 +0800 发布dimmer-V1.0.10 1、修改按键进入产测的时间10秒变成5秒; 2、添加进入产测后,每5秒上报一次温度; 3、修改了电网60hz、50hz检测出错的问题; 4、优化输出功率等级的不均匀问题; 5、产测完成后,增加上报产测完成信息; 6、优化了白光显示效果; Date: Fri Dec 7 16:59:03 2018 +0800 发布dimmer-V1.0.09 1、修改亮度从最高档,快速按down键6次下调亮度,第二档指示灯不灭的问题; 2、修改rgb颜色与app不匹配的问题; 3、修改更换账号,没有删除timer的问题; 4、修改更换账号,rgb、指示灯显示不正确的问题; Date: Mon Dec 3 17:18:01 2018 +0800 发布dimmer-V1.0.08 1、解决了软启动光闪的问题; 2、修改了rgb、指示灯开灯的状态与上次断电或者关机前状态不一致的问题; 3、修改了通过IFTTT调节设备亮度,上报RGB,指示灯的状态; 4、修改了设备恢复出厂设置时,RGB、指示灯的状态为开启; Date: Fri Nov 30 17:25:23 2018 +0800 发布dimmer-V1.0.07 1、在关机状态下,"powerBright":80能够开机,只上报"powerBright","powerOn"状态,改为上报"brightness","powerOn","powerBright"; 2、优化了调光上报延时2秒的问题。改为立即上报亮度; 3、修改了在第一档位时,执行timer结束时光闪的问题; Date: Thu Nov 29 13:45:01 2018 +0800 发布dimmer-V1.0.06 1、修改了power按键或者app关闭灯时,没有删除timer的问题; 2、修改了once tomorrow执行错误的问题; 3、出厂设置参数灯开关,rgb开关,指示灯开关,修改成默认关灯,关RGB,关LED指示灯; 4、增加了json字段"powerBright":80,用于ifttt控制; 5、修改了删除设备后,重新配网,WIFI指示灯不亮的问题; Date: Tue Nov 27 18:38:51 2018 +0800 发布dimmer-V1.0.05 1、修改了长按设备15秒以上,设备没有重置,APP没有删除设备的问题; 2、修改了固件已经在APN\smart配网模式(WiFi指示灯在慢\快闪)下,再次长按按键配网,前5秒WiFi指示灯LED亮的问题; 3、修改了设备的网络信息已经删除,但WiFi指示灯还是常亮的问题; 4、修改了schedule执行时的灯光亮度值与schedule中设置的不一样的问题; 5、修改了timer定时器,断网后,power指示灯和档位进度条的显示状态错误的问题; 6、修改了schedule显示once tomorrow,开始时间能正常操作设备,结束不能执行的问题; 7、修改了设备重新上电后,没有恢复断电前的状态的问题; Date: Wed Nov 21 18:11:48 2018 +0800 发布dimmer-V1.0.04 1、修复上报版本号时少了version一层,导致不能通过APP更新的BUG; 2、修改了wifi指示灯、档位指示灯显示的问题; 3、修改了亮度与档位指示灯不一致的问题; 4、修改了schedule结束后,亮度不对应的问题; Date: Mon Nov 19 17:37:41 2018 +0800 发布dimmer-V1.0.03 1、解决了timer结束后play无法运行的问题; 2、解决了schedule跨天无法执行的问题; 3、增加schedule startact执行上报brigness; 4、增加长按按键无极调光; 5、解决了软启动问题,亮度变化时间统一为2秒;